I have a WDM USB driver doing USB ISOCH Hi-Speed streaming.
I have sometimes the issue that an URB (Urb->UrbHeader.Status) will return with the error message:
The "Irp->IoStatus.Status" is:
I know that I do not call the AbortPipe request (I guess it is the Windows USB driver) and I have no idea what goes wrong at all.
I setup a sample which will do nothing in my asynchronous callback only resend the IRP, to check if I'm doing something wrong here but the stream can work for longer time and all of the sudden one URB will return with this error.
Is there a way to check out in more detail why and where from this error appears or any other suggestion ?
Many thank and best regards,
It looks like you're new here. If you want to get involved, click one of these buttons!
|Upcoming OSR Seminars|
|Writing WDF Drivers||21 Oct 2019||OSR Seminar Space & ONLINE|
|Internals & Software Drivers||18 Nov 2019||Dulles, VA|
|Kernel Debugging||30 Mar 2020||OSR Seminar Space|
|Developing Minifilters||27 Apr 2020||OSR Seminar Space & ONLINE|